Yes Don, you're right except for one important point - our Prime Minister is NOT the President. It's the PARTY that's elected to power, not a person. The Prime Minister is merely what his title suggests, the leader of the Cabinet of Ministers that make up the Government. It's impossible to have a Prime Minister whose party doesn't have a greater number of MPs than any other individual party in The House Of Commons, unlike the States where the President may be from the minority party. And the Prime Minister can be removed from office by the members of his own party, or by a vote of no confidence by the members of the House of Commons. The Prime Minister of Great Britain has far less power than the President of the USA, and his position is considerably less secure.
